From the Lawrence Daily World for Jan. 12, 1909: “To run the city government of Lawrence the past year cost the citizens a little more than $125,000 exclusive of the issuance of bonds for special improvements. This seems like a tremendous sum but when the various items are explained it can be seen that Lawrence has an extremely efficient and economical city government. The facts and figures are available to the public. … For the second time, the Jayhawk basketball team humbled Nebraska on the Robinson Gymnasium court last night with a lopsided score of 36-17. … A relentless war on liquor and the liquor traffic was closed today when J.R. Woodward turned over the office of sheriff to W.R. Banning. Woodward had a wonderful record that the new sheriff will have to work hard to match. Woodward made nearly 100 arrests in his tenure and got convictions in many of the cases.”
